Friday's Cable Ratings: Big Finish for "Wizards of Waverly Place"
By The Futon Critic Staff (TFC)

select cable nielsen ratings
(national numbers for friday, january 6, 2012)

Here are the highlights of 22 ad-sustained programs that aired in primetime on the cable networks last night, courtesy of TravisYanan:

Wizards of Waverly Place (9.755 million viewers, #1; adults 18-49: 1.9, #T1)

Jessie (7.317 million viewers, #2; adults 18-49: 1.2, #3)

Gold Rush (4.688 million viewers, #3; adults 18-49: 1.9, #T1)

Fish Hooks (4.375 million viewers, #4; adults 18-49: 0.6, #T8)

WWE Smackdown (2.589 million viewers, #5; adults 18-49: 0.8, #T4)

Flying Wild Alaska (2.198 million viewers, #6; adults 18-49: 0.8, #T4)

NBA Basketball: Chicago/Orlando (1.794 million viewers, #7; adults 18-49: 0.8, #T4)

House of Payne (9:30) (1.606 million viewers, #8; adults 18-49: 0.7, #7)

Merlin (1.602 million viewers, #9; adults 18-49: 0.4, #T13)

Say Yes to the Dress: Atlanta (9:30) (1.474 million viewers, #10; adults 18-49: 0.4, #T13)

House of Payne (9:00) (1.416 million viewers, #11; adults 18-49: 0.6, #T8)

Four Weddings (1.406 million viewers, #12; adults 18-49: 0.5, #T11)

Star Wars: The Clone Wars (1.388 million viewers, #13; adults 18-49: 0.4, #T13)

NBA Basketball: Portland/Phoenix (1.290 million viewers, #14; adults 18-49: 0.6, #T8)

Say Yes to the Dress: Atlanta (9:00) (1.255 million viewers, #15; adults 18-49: 0.3, #T17)

America's Most Wanted (1.043 million viewers, #16; adults 18-49: 0.3, #T17)

Generator Rex (0.940 million viewers, #17; adults 18-49: 0.3, #T17)

Fashion Police (0.935 million viewers, #18; adults 18-49: 0.5, #T11)

Infested! (0.824 million viewers, #19; adults 18-49: 0.4, #T13)

The Soup (Repeat) (0.601 million viewers, #20; adults 18-49: 0.3, #T17)

Confessions: Animal Hoarding (10:00) (0.552 million viewers, #21; adults 18-49: 0.2, #21)

The Life & Times of Tim (0.170 million viewers, #22; adults 18-49: 0.1, #22)

Source: Nielsen Media Research
